1967 - 1968 Jack Instructions Decal

-
I made a jack decal for my 1967 Chevrolet truck a while back and sold a few extra ones. I made a few more up to see if anyone else needed one. The first picture gives you an idea of the quality and the second picture shows one installed in my '67 Chevy pickup. This decal is correct for all 1967's, and it is also correct for 1968's with Buddy Buckets..These decals are not available through the regular vendors, they only carry the later style decals. The decal has a peel & stick backing for easy application. $7.50 each shipped.

Quote:
Originally Posted by shawno72 View Post
I have buddy buckets that I had the frame powder coated and I don't remember where the sticker goes. I have seen some on the outside like your pic shows and some in the inside of the center console. How do you know where the correct placement is?
Shawn,

Don't take this as gospel but I think the '67's were inside the console and '68's were outside. It could also have been specific to which production plant the truck was built at. I'm not aware of any research done on this subject.
